Install RKNN python package following [rknn-toolkit2 doc](https://github.com/rockchip-linux/rknn-toolkit2/tree/master/doc) or [rknn-toolkit doc](https://github.com/rockchip-linux/rknn-toolkit/tree/master/doc). When installing rknn python package, it is better to append `--no-deps` after the commands to avoid dependency conflicts. RKNN-Toolkit2 package for example:
3. Install ONNX==1.8.0 before reinstall MMDeploy from source following the [instructions](../01-how-to-build/build_from_source.md). Note that there are conflicts between the pip dependencies of MMDeploy and RKNN. Here is the suggested packages versions for python 3.6:
```
protobuf==3.19.4
onnx==1.8.0
onnxruntime==1.8.0
torch==1.8.0
torchvision==0.9.0
```

With the deployment config, you can modify the `backend_config` for your preference. An example `backend_config` of mmclassification is shown as below:
The contents of `common_config` are for `rknn.config()`. The contents of `quantization_config` are used to control `rknn.build()`. You may have to modify `target_platform` for your own preference.
2. For linux, download gcc cross compiler. The download link of the compiler from the official user guide of `rknpu2` was deprecated. You may use another verified [link](https://github.com/Caesar-github/gcc-buildroot-9.3.0-2020.03-x86_64_aarch64-rockchip-linux-gnu). After download and unzip the compiler, you may open the terminal, set `RKNN_TOOL_CHAIN` and `RKNPU2_DEVICE_DIR` by `export RKNN_TOOL_CHAIN=/path/to/gcc/usr;export RKNPU2_DEVICE_DIR=/path/to/rknpu2/runtime/RK3588`.
